Understanding the Louisiana Emancipation Process

The Louisiana emancipation form is a legal document that allows a minor to gain independence from their parents or guardians before reaching the age of majority. Emancipation can grant minors the ability to make their own decisions regarding education, healthcare, and living arrangements. To initiate this process, the minor must demonstrate their ability to support themselves financially and manage their own affairs. Understanding the requirements and implications of emancipation is crucial for anyone considering this step.

Eligibility Criteria for Emancipation in Louisiana

To qualify for emancipation in Louisiana, a minor must meet specific criteria. Generally, the individual must be at least 16 years old and capable of supporting themselves. They must also provide evidence of their maturity and ability to handle responsibilities. Additionally, the minor must show that emancipation is in their best interest and that they have a stable living situation. Legal counsel can assist in navigating these requirements effectively.

Steps to Complete the Louisiana Emancipation Form

Filling out the Louisiana emancipation form involves several key steps:

  1. Gather necessary documentation, including proof of income, living arrangements, and any supporting letters from guardians or social workers.
  2. Complete the emancipation form accurately, ensuring all information is truthful and comprehensive.
  3. File the completed form with the appropriate court in your jurisdiction, along with any required fees.
  4. Attend the court hearing, where a judge will review the case and determine whether to grant emancipation.

Required Documents for the Emancipation Process

When applying for emancipation, specific documents must be submitted alongside the Louisiana emancipation form. These typically include:

  • Proof of income, such as pay stubs or tax returns.
  • Identification documents, including a birth certificate or state-issued ID.
  • Evidence of living arrangements, such as a lease agreement or letter from a guardian.
  • Any additional documentation that supports the minor's case for emancipation.

Legal Implications of Emancipation in Louisiana

Emancipation carries significant legal implications for minors. Once emancipated, individuals can enter into contracts, make medical decisions, and manage their finances independently. However, it also means that they may lose certain protections that minors typically enjoy, such as parental support and guidance. Understanding these implications is essential before proceeding with the emancipation process.

Form Submission Methods for Louisiana Emancipation

The Louisiana emancipation form can be submitted through various methods, including:

  • In-person submission at the local courthouse, where the minor resides.
  • Mailing the completed form and supporting documents to the appropriate court.
  • Consulting with legal counsel to ensure proper submission and compliance with local regulations.
